Description

Grain storage device convenient to adjust
Technical Field
The utility model relates to a grain storage technology field specifically is a grain storage device convenient to adjust.
Background
In the grain storage process, it is distinguished between the degree of drying of grain and the quality of grain, and simultaneously, the grain total amount of different qualities is also different, for this reason we are more and more high to grain storage device's requirement, hope can improve grain storage device's availability factor through the innovation to grain storage device, convenient categorised the depositing, make it exert the biggest value, along with the development of science and technology, the grain storage device of the regulation of being convenient for has had very big development, its development has brought very big facility for people when carrying out the volume adjustment of depositing the grain groove to grain storage, its kind and quantity are also increasing day by day.
Although the types and the number of the grain storage devices which are convenient to adjust on the market are very large, the grain storage devices which are convenient to adjust have the following defects: grain storage device is not convenient for classify and deposits, and grain storage device is not convenient for adjust the baffle of not being convenient for of depositing the grain space and grain storage device in groove of depositing grain and dismantles. Therefore, the grain storage device which is convenient to adjust at present needs to be improved.

Compared with the prior art, the beneficial effects of the utility model are that: this grain storage device convenient to adjust:
1. the grain storage device is provided with a first grain storage groove, a second grain storage groove and a third grain storage groove, when grain storage is needed, the grain storage device is divided into three standards according to the quality of the grain, the grain divided into the three standards is injected into the first grain storage groove, the second grain storage groove and the third grain storage groove respectively, and the first partition plate, the second partition plate and the third partition plate among the first grain storage groove, the second grain storage groove and the third grain storage groove are used for conveniently classifying the grain with different qualities;
2. the grain storage device is provided with a connecting channel, and when the storage capacity of each granary in the granary needs to be adjusted, the positions of the first partition plate, the second partition plate and the third partition plate on the second sliding groove and the first sliding rail are adjusted according to the grain storage proportion required to be injected in the first grain storage groove, the second grain storage groove and the third grain storage groove, so that the total grain storage amount of each storage groove is conveniently adjusted;
3. be provided with second slide rail and third spout, when each baffle is dismantled in needs installation, dismantle the fixed plate on first baffle, second baffle and the third baffle side link earlier and get off, later through the sliding structure between second slide rail and the third spout, the pulling second baffle is dismantled the second baffle, dismantles first baffle and third baffle again to the convenience is dismantled first baffle, second baffle and third baffle.

The working principle is as follows: when the grain storage device convenient to adjust is used, firstly, according to the grain storage proportion needed to be injected into the first grain storage groove 8, the second grain storage groove 9 and the third grain storage groove 10, the positions of the first partition plate 15, the second partition plate 16 and the third partition plate 17 on the second sliding chute 13 and the first sliding rail 14 are adjusted, the first partition plate 15 and the third partition plate 17 are clamped into the second sliding chute 13 and the first sliding rail 14 on two sides of the connecting channel 12 through the second sliding rail 18 and the third sliding chute 19, then the second partition plate 16 is clamped and connected between the first partition plate 15 and the third partition plate 17, then the fixing plate 21 is fixedly connected with the connecting frame 20 through the through hole 22, when the grain storage is needed, the grain cover 6 on the top of the grain bin 1 is opened by using a tool, the grain storage device is divided into three standards according to the quality of the grain, and simultaneously, the grain divided into three standards is injected into the first grain storage groove 8, the second grain storage groove 9 and the third grain, In the second grain storage tank 9 and the third grain storage tank 10, grains with different qualities are classified and stored through a first partition plate 15, a second partition plate 16 and a third partition plate 17 between the first grain storage tank 8, the second grain storage tank 9 and the third grain storage tank 10, and the contents which are not described in detail in the description belong to the prior art which is well known to those skilled in the art.
